¿En qué formato las compañías de cable almacenan programas de TV a pedido?

Una emisora ​​preprocesará todo el material de una copia maestra (ya sea tomada de la transmisión ‘fuera del aire’ o del material original).

Generarán múltiples archivos dependiendo de la calidad / ancho de banda y también los códecs y los contenedores de formato de medios. Raramente la emisora ​​tiene la suerte de tener solo un requisito de códec para los servicios de actualización que ofrece, es posible que necesite MPEG2 TS, mp4, Microsoft Smooth Streaming y HLS.

Para una tasa de bits adaptativa, los archivos se cortarán en fragmentos para que la transmisión pueda cambiar la calidad / ancho de banda a mitad del programa (los usuarios no deberían notar nada más que un cambio en la calidad mientras miran).

Es posible que también deba aplicarse DRM, pero esto será específico del formato del contenedor, el códec y el reproductor. Un proveedor puede necesitar múltiples DRM para admitir diferentes dispositivos.

La transmisión en estos días es solo un servidor HTTP optimizado que envía archivos al cliente.

Depende del proveedor que proporcione la solución para la compañía de cable. Estoy bastante seguro de decir que todos los proveedores en este espacio (incluido aquí en Cisco) implementan un mecanismo de almacenamiento en caché similar a CDN para almacenar y transmitir a pedido. Todo el contenido se almacena en un conjunto de servidores centralizados ubicados en centros de datos en todo el país y luego se extrae / empuja a servidores perimetrales más pequeños más cerca de donde se encuentra el suscriptor.

Los activos a pedido se transmiten según sea necesario con muchos suscriptores que consumen transmisiones individuales que generalmente se obtienen del mismo archivo de origen. Algunos proveedores almacenan contenido utilizando un formato estandarizado MPEG-TS. Este es el mismo formato que se utiliza para transmitir a su decodificador de cable (puede ser MPEG2 o 4 dependiendo de las capacidades de su decodificador). Otros proveedores pueden almacenar el activo en un formato propietario que luego se convierte a MPEG-TS cuando comienza la transmisión.

Tenga en cuenta que lo anterior es una descripción de cómo funcionan las cosas la mayor parte del tiempo. Ciertamente, hay otros sistemas a pedido que se implementan en América del Norte y en todo el mundo que utilizan formatos de archivo basados ​​en la tasa de bits adaptable (ABR), pero su decodificador promedio en el campo hoy en día usa MPEG-TS como formato de transmisión.